perf evlist: Remove __evlist__add_default
Browse files Browse the repository at this point in the history
__evlist__add_default adds a cycles event to a typically empty evlist
and was extended for hybrid with evlist__add_default_hybrid, as more
than 1 PMU was necessary. Rather than have dedicated logic for the
cycles event, this change switches to parsing 'cycles:P' which will
handle wildcarding the PMUs appropriately for hybrid.
